In this paper the floral ontogeny and the ovary development of rivina humilis l. were observed. the results showed that ( 1 ) the tepal primordia initiated in 2 / 5 spirals. the abaxial one initiated first, then the adaxial one, finally the lateral two initiated nearly simultaneously. the third one initiated on the position near the first tepal, and there is a gap between itself and the second tepal. ( 2 ) the 4 stamineal primordia initiated in one whorl at the same time. ( 3 ) the carpellary primordium initiated from the abaxial side of flower primordium ; the carpellary primordium grew upwards and towards axis after it was formed, therefore an elliptic orifice was formed at the adaxial position of ovary, which was the remainder of the mouth of ovary before the ovary was fused completely. with the ovary maturing, the orifice was narrowed because of the ovary growth, at last fused completely. the gynoecium is composed of a single carpel. ( 4 ) in the series developmental sections of ovary, the ovular primordium was initiated on the adaxial meristem when the mouth of ovary was formed

A discretization equation is derived by using a finite volume method in three - dimensional cylindrical polar coordinate system. algebraic equations are solved by iteration with a line - by - line method that is a combination of tdma in axial and radial directions, ctdma in tangential direction and adi method in three directions. the pressure and velocity coupling are solved with the simple algorithm
